General annotation (Comments)

Function

May be involved in decane metabolism and autophagy. Involved in the biosynthesis of sterol glucoside By similarity.

Catalytic activity

UDP-glucose + a sterol = UDP + a sterol 3-beta-D-glucoside.

Subcellular location

Membrane; Peripheral membrane protein Potential.

Sequence similarities

Belongs to the glycosyltransferase 28 family.

Contains 2 GRAM domains.

Contains 1 PH domain.
